Home >Web Front-end >Front-end Q&A >Analyze the problem of Vue route jump not loading
Vue is a popular front-end framework that provides a flexible way to manage front-end routing. However, sometimes when using Vue routing, we will encounter some problems, one of which is that the route jump does not load. This situation often results in the page not being displayed correctly and can severely impact the user experience. In this article, we will explore the causes of this problem and provide some possible solutions.
Cause Analysis
Failure to load routing jumps is usually related to the following aspects:
1. Routing configuration error: If the routing configuration is incorrect, it may cause a jump Not loading. For example, if the correct path is missing in the routing configuration file, or the name is incorrect, the routing jump will not be loaded.
2. Cache: If there is a cache in the browser, it may cause the route jump to not load. Especially when using Vue's development mode, there may be a cache in the browser, which will prevent the program from loading new routing pages correctly.
3. Component loading failure: If an error occurs during the routing component loading process, the routing jump will not be loaded. For example, if the component file path is wrong, the component file is damaged, etc., it may cause the component to fail to load, resulting in routing jumps that are not loaded.
Solution
Based on the above reasons, we can take the following methods to solve the problem of route jump not loading:
1. Check the routing configuration: If the routing configuration appears If an error occurs, we should check whether the routing configuration file is correct. First confirm whether the path is correct, and then check whether the file naming is standardized. This will help ensure that the route jump is loaded normally.
2. Clear browser cache: In order to solve the problem of browser cache, we can try to clear the cache in the browser and ensure that no old cache files exist in the browser. We can achieve this by clearing the cache in the browser settings or using cache-less mode in development mode.
3. Check the component file: If the routing component fails to load, we should check the component file path, file naming, etc. to ensure that the component file is not damaged or has errors. In addition, we can also try to load other components to determine whether there is a problem with component loading failure.
Conclusion
In this article, we discussed the reasons why Vue route jumps are not loading and provided some possible solutions. It's important to note that these workarounds may not work in every situation, and the best approach is to double-check your code and configuration files and make sure they are correct. At the same time, during the development process, we should learn how to debug the problem of route jumps not loading, which will help speed up development.
The above is the detailed content of Analyze the problem of Vue route jump not loading. For more information, please follow other related articles on the PHP Chinese website!